Unlocking the Bounty Bonanza
First, you can’t stroll into any region demanding bounties. Teyvat has rules, people! Unlock the City Reputation system first. You need to hit Adventure Rank 25. This acts as your entry ticket into regional reputation.
Once past that point, nations have unique requirements for bounties. Here’s a region breakdown:
- Mondstadt: The City of Freedom is not so free for reputation unlocks. Achieve Reputation Level 2 here before bounty boards become available. You need to charm those Knights of Favonius!
- Inazuma: In the land of Electro and eternity, talk with Madarame Hyakubei. Chat with him to unlock the Inazuma Reputation menu. Quests, requests, and bounties await in Inazuma. More info on Game Rant’s guide to Inazuma Reputation.
- Sumeru: The realm of Dendro and deserts only needs you to hit Sumeru Reputation Level 2. Achieve this, and bounties emerge. No fighting Ruin Guards here.
- Fontaine: Ready to wade into justice? First, progress through the Archon Questline. Complete Act II of the Fontaine Archon Quest. Afterward, find Euphrasie, Fontaine’s Reputation NPC, at the Steambird sipping on something fancy.
- Natlan: Natlan has its own unlock needs. Navigate the main storyline again. Finish the ‘Pilgrimage of the Return of the Sacred Flame’ quest from Chapter 5, Act 1 Natlan Archon Quest. After this fiery quest, Natlan’s reputation system welcomes you. For more, Eurogamer has a guide on Natlan Reputation.
Bounty Hunting 101: How to Snag Those Rewards
You’ve unlocked bounties! Congratulations! But how do you do them? It’s simple. Let’s assume you’re starting in Mondstadt, because it’s classic Genshin.
After reaching Reputation Level 2 there, head to the Reputation NPC, which is Hertha. Chat with her, and you can accept bounties. Click and the hunt begins!
In Mondstadt and Liyue, there’s a mini-detective game. Use your Elemental Sight. Activate it and search the bounty area for three clues. Look for glowing spots highlighting something related to your target. Footprints, disturbed terrain, or perhaps a hilichurl upset about cabbage theft await. Interact with all three clues, like a scavenger hunt where winning means battling a tougher monster.
When you successfully gather clues, the bounty target appears. Expect a stronger foe, perhaps a vengeful Ruin Guard or a powerful slime ready for a fight. Defeat this target and show them who’s tough. Bring your best team; these baddies hit hard.
Triumphant? Excellent! Just remember to claim your reward afterward. Return to the Reputation NPC who gave you the bounty. Talk again and collect your bounty rewards. Simple as that.
The Spoils of War: Bounty Rewards
What do you gain from monster hunting and clue-seeking? Obviously, Reputation EXP! Completing bounties grants 60, 80, 100, or 120 Reputation EXP, depending on its difficulty and region. This EXP helps raise the reputation level for the nation or tribe where you accepted it. It unlocks various region-specific rewards like crafting recipes for Fontaine’s weapons, as Game Rant reveals, gadgets, and even wings within the skies. Plus, bragging rights!
Bounty Limitations: Don’t Get Greedy
Before you dive into bounty hunting full-time, a catch exists. Bounties cannot be endless. You have a weekly limit. You can complete a total of 3 bounties each week. And here’s the twist: this limit is shared across all nations. So if you complete 3 in Mondstadt, you can’t do more that week, even if Liyue beckons. Choose wisely to boost your reputation.
Tracking Your Targets
Tracking your weekly bounty count remains simple. Just open the Reputation menu for any region. It shows how many bounties you’ve completed and how many remain. No need for spreadsheets or carrier pigeons!
